One of the most alarming incidents occurred in 2022, when a hacked Ukrainian television station broadcast a deepfake of President Volodymyr Zelenskyy, appearing to order his soldiers to surrender to Russian forces. Beyond explicit media, the same technology used by these networks can be weaponized to manufacture fake statements from political figures, corporate executives, or public leaders.
